New York Jets injury news today focuses on veteran safety Marcus Maye, who will be out 3 to 4 weeks with an ankle injury, according to Ian Rapoport. Maye has been one of the best players on the Jets’ defense this season, and replacing him will not be easy. However, the Jets are set to get some help from previous injured safeties in Ashtyn Davis and Sharrod Neasman. Wide receiver Jamison Crowder should make his 2021 NFL season debut vs. the Tennessee Titans. Crowder has not played after testing positive for COVID-19 and then suffering a groin injury. Crowder’s availability should help QB Zach Wilson, especially with WR Elijah Moore dealing with a concussion.
